Journal ArticleDOI
Extracellular vesicles isolated from patients undergoing remote ischemic preconditioning decrease hypoxia-evoked apoptosis of cardiomyoblasts after isoflurane but not propofol exposure.
Frederik Abel,Florian Murke,Morten Gaida,Nicolas Garnier,Crista Ochsenfarth,Carsten Theiss,Matthias Thielmann,Petra Kleinbongard,Bernd Giebel,Jürgen Peters,Ulrich H. Frey,Ulrich H. Frey +11 more
TL;DR: Vesicles isolated from patients undergoing RIPC under isoflurane anesthesia protect H9c2 cardiomyoblasts against hypoxia-evoked apoptosis and this effect is abrogated by propofol, which supports a role of human RIPC-generated EVs in cardioprotection and underlines prop ofol as a possible confounder inRIPC-signaling mediated by EVs.
Journal ArticleDOI
Proteomics/phosphoproteomics of left ventricular biopsies from patients with surgical coronary revascularization and pigs with coronary occlusion/reperfusion: remote ischemic preconditioning
Nilgün Gedik,Marcus Krüger,Matthias Thielmann,Eva Kottenberg,Andreas Skyschally,Ulrich H. Frey,Elke Cario,Jürgen Peters,Heinz Jakob,Gerd Heusch,Petra Kleinbongard +10 more
TL;DR: In left ventricular biopsies from patients undergoing coronary artery bypass grafting and from pigs undergoing coronary occlusion/reperfusion without (sham) and with RIPC, only the activation of signal transducer and activator of transcription 5 was associated withRIPC’s cardioprotection.
Journal ArticleDOI
A novel functional haplotype in the human GNAS gene alters Gαs expression, responsiveness to β-adrenoceptor stimulation, and peri-operative cardiac performance
Ulrich H. Frey,Michael Adamzik,Eva Kottenberg-Assenmacher,Heinz Jakob,Iris Manthey,Martina Broecker-Preuss,Lars Bergmann,Gerd Heusch,Winfried Siffert,Jürgen Peters,Kirsten Leineweber +10 more
TL;DR: SNPs in regulatory regions of GNAS impact upon Galphas expression and stimulated cAMP formation in human hearts in vitro and upon cardiac performance in vivo.
Journal ArticleDOI
Lethal acute respiratory distress syndrome during anti-TNF-α therapy for rheumatoid arthritis
TL;DR: In patients receiving anti-TNF-α therapy, especially in combination with corticosteroids, signs of pulmonary infection should be regarded as very serious, as fulminant pneumonia with ARDS and severe sepsis may develop within 24 h.
